STATE v. HIGLEY

No. 16716-6-II.

78 Wn. App. 172 (1995)

902 P.2d 659

STATE OF WASHINGTON, Respondent, v. JOHN ERIC HIGLEY, Appellant.

The Court of Appeals of Washington, Division Two.

June 13, 1995.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lenell R. Nussbaum, for appellant.

Pamela Loginsky, Deputy Prosecuting Attorney, for respondent.


MORGAN, J.

John Eric Higley appeals a conviction for vehicular assault. We affirm.

On July 4, 1989, a car driven by Higley collided with a car driven by Teri Dixon. Higley was intoxicated at the time. Dixon struck her head on the windshield and was taken to the hospital. The hospital medical staff did not think Dixon was seriously injured,1 and someone so informed the investigating state trooper.
